File content as of revision 12:beb0d7632531:
#include "Graphics.h"
const int Graphics::SCREEN_HEIGHT = 84;
const int Graphics::SCREEN_WIDTH = 48;
const int Graphics::BLOCK_SIZE = 4;
const int Graphics::BORDER_SIZE = 2;
N5110 * Graphics::lcd;
void Graphics::init() {
lcd = new N5110(PTC9,PTC0,PTC7,PTD2,PTD1,PTC11);
lcd->init();
lcd->setContrast(0.5);
}
void Graphics::deinit() {
delete lcd;
}
void Graphics::clear() {
lcd->clear();
}
void Graphics::render() {
lcd->refresh();
}
void Graphics::drawPoint(int x, int y) {
lcd->setPixel(x, y, true);
}
void Graphics::drawLine(int x1, int y1, int x2, int y2) {
lcd->drawLine(x1, y1, x2, y2, 1);
}
void Graphics::drawDottedLine(int x1, int y1, int x2, int y2) {
lcd->drawLine(
y1,
x1,
y2,
x2,
2 // dotted
);
}
void Graphics::drawBox(int x1, int y1, int x2, int y2) {
Graphics::drawLine(x1, y1, x2, y1);
Graphics::drawLine(x2, y1, x2, y2);
Graphics::drawLine(x2, y2, x1, y2);
Graphics::drawLine(x1, y2, x1, y1);
}
void Graphics::drawBlock(int grid_x, int grid_y) {
// screen coords
int x = gridYToScreenX(grid_y);
int y = gridXToScreenY(grid_x);
Graphics::drawBox(x, y, x + 3, y - 3);
Graphics::drawPoint(x + 2, y - 2);
}
void Graphics::drawBorder() {
Graphics::drawDottedLine(0, 0, 0, SCREEN_HEIGHT - 1);
Graphics::drawDottedLine(1, 1, 1, SCREEN_HEIGHT - 2);
Graphics::drawDottedLine(0, SCREEN_HEIGHT - 1, SCREEN_WIDTH - 1, SCREEN_HEIGHT - 1);
Graphics::drawDottedLine(1, SCREEN_HEIGHT - 2, SCREEN_WIDTH - 2, SCREEN_HEIGHT - 2);
Graphics::drawDottedLine(SCREEN_WIDTH - 1, SCREEN_HEIGHT - 1, SCREEN_WIDTH - 1, 0);
Graphics::drawDottedLine(SCREEN_WIDTH - 2, SCREEN_HEIGHT - 2, SCREEN_WIDTH - 2, 1);
}
int Graphics::gridYToScreenX(int grid_y) {
return grid_y * BLOCK_SIZE + BORDER_SIZE;
}
int Graphics::gridXToScreenY(int grid_x) {
return SCREEN_WIDTH - (grid_x * BLOCK_SIZE) - BORDER_SIZE;
}
